Do I need to reinstall Diskeeper after installing a Service Pack?
We recommend uninstalling Diskeeper, installing the service pack, then reinstalling Diskeeper. Under Windows NT 3.51, this is mandatory because certain system files are modified by Diskeeper. If you do not follow this procedure, you will have to reinstall the Service Pack, and possibly reinstall Windows NT.
Under Windows NT 4.0 Diskeeper does not modify any system files, but we still recommend this procedure because the service pack may change the registry entry for Diskeeper. However, you do not need a new version of Diskeeper for Windows NT 4.0 service packs.
